Instructions for MAX202CDR:

  1. Power Supply Connection: Connect the VCC pin to a 5V power supply and GND to ground. Ensure stable power supply to avoid data corruption.
  2. RS-232 Interface: The MAX202CDR is designed to interface TTL levels to RS-232 levels. Connect TXD from your microcontroller to the T1IN pin, and RXD to R1OUT pin on the MAX202CDR.
  3. Capacitor Connections: Place capacitors as specified in the datasheet near the VCC and GND pins to ensure stability. Typically, a 0.1渭F capacitor is used for decoupling.
  4. Data Transmission: For transmitting data, apply TTL level signals to T1IN. The MAX202CDR converts these to RS-232 levels at T1OUT.
  5. Data Reception: Received RS-232 signals should be connected to R1IN, which are then converted to TTL levels available at R1OUT.
  6. Protective Measures: Use appropriate transient voltage suppressors if the environment is prone to electrical noise or surges.
  7. Temperature Considerations: Ensure that the operating temperature does not exceed the specified limits to prevent damage or malfunction.
